APPLETON - The COVID-19 vaccine clinic at the Fox Cities Exhibition Center will close at the end of May, a spokesperson for the city of Appleton confirmed Monday morning.
The clinic launched Feb. 2 as a partnership between tri-county health departments, ThedaCare, Ascension Wisconsin and a number of other health care organizations in the Fox Valley. To date, staff have administered more than 27,000 shots.
